rampart [i r2mpZ:Rt, `pqRt ]    (¼øÀ§: 9372 - ´ëÇÐ ¼öÁØ)  
¶æ ¸í) ¼ºº®, ´©º®
Mean A fortification consisting of an embankment, often with a parapet built on top.
¡¡